Transaction 29ba8b8accdf36284808cbd18e2a8ccbec4159daf9138a7a2eec86499614fb04
1 Input
1 Output
-
29ba8b8accdf36284808cbd18e2a8ccbec4159daf9138a7a2eec86499614fb04:0
- value
- 576157
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aeaa98f93e607e603a7ff787b3070f754bab14f2 OP_EQUAL
- address
- 3HcZsFLfoXG7kamVRnMs4BBFqPqLRv2u3a